你查询的IP:[119.128.61.107]  地理位置:中国–广东–东莞

最新查询123.101.226.20 118.248.255.19 202.96.251.142 220.252.217.18 125.169.225.82 119.80.203.210 219.216.98.229 116.192.79.120 120.150.167.79 119.128.61.107 116.76.31.41 203.166.160.150 116.199.128.74 202.181.112.246 116.60.130.114 60.252.77.107 120.32.236.85 203.89.108.177 59.64.167.208 210.2.152.125 116.60.89.64 117.58.87.236 116.224.219.126 202.41.240.14 124.128.78.90 58.24.23.165 203.91.96.212 122.204.249.5 202.38.128.7 203.119.32.244 202.38.160.200